  "agent_context": "Gemini Managed Agents now default to **Gemini 3.6 Flash**. The service adds pre- and post-tool hooks, explicit model selection, scheduled triggers, free-tier access, environment management, and persistent files across scheduled runs.\n\nAdd hooks where tool calls need policy checks, linting, or audit output, and set **max_total_tokens** on autonomous loops. A capped run pauses as incomplete while preserving its environment, so it can resume with a new budget and previous interaction ID.\n\nThe agent remains a preview identified as antigravity-preview-05-2026. Scheduled runs reuse a sandbox, which is useful for stateful work but makes cleanup, state drift, and hook failure behavior important operational concerns.",
